Why Liver Health Is the Foundation of Recovery

You can only go as hard as your liver and gut will allow.

The liver is involved in almost every major process related to regeneration:

  • Detoxifying metabolic waste and environmental toxins
  • Processing hormones so they stay in balance
  • Managing carbohydrate and fat metabolism
  • Storing and releasing energy when you need it
  • Building proteins, including many used for repair

When liver function is overloaded or sluggish, you feel it as:

  • Low energy and constant fatigue
  • Slow recovery between sessions
  • Increased sensitivity to alcohol or junk food
  • More inflammation and joint pain
  • Brain fog and low mood

The gut is equally important. A damaged gut lining means poor nutrient absorption, more inflammation, and a weaker immune system. Even the best diet does not help if your digestive tract cannot properly absorb and use what you eat.

Interesting Perspectives on Liver & Gut Peptides

The concept of using targeted peptides for organ regeneration opens up unconventional applications. Some researchers and biohackers are exploring angles beyond basic detox support:

  • Cross-Organ Communication: The liver-gut axis is a two-way street. Supporting the liver with peptides like those in Ovagen 50 may positively influence the gut microbiome composition, and vice-versa, creating a positive feedback loop for systemic health. This aligns with a holistic view of regeneration where you don’t just treat an organ in isolation.
  • Performance Beyond Digestion: A high-functioning liver improves the clearance of ammonia, a byproduct of intense exercise that contributes to central fatigue. Therefore, liver-support peptides could have a direct, albeit indirect, ergogenic benefit for endurance athletes by potentially delaying fatigue at the neural level.
  • Contrarian Take on “Toxins”: While mainstream health focuses on external toxins, a high-performance perspective emphasizes endogenous metabolic waste—like inflammatory cytokines, spent hormones, and lactate. A peptide that upregulates liver regeneration may enhance the body’s innate processing capacity for these internal byproducts of an intense lifestyle, which is often a greater daily burden than environmental toxins.
  • Longevity & Cellular Turnover: The principle behind peptide bioregulators is to encourage optimal cellular turnover and tissue-specific protein synthesis. From a longevity standpoint, maintaining a youthful capacity for liver regeneration (hepatocyte proliferation) and gut lining integrity is foundational to preventing age-related declines in metabolism and nutrient absorption.
